Most series that don't want to have a progressing story do this.
Rick&Morty is mostly "filler" but will progress the story in the finale.
Futurama is basically just filler except sprinkling in a story that progresses the characters every now and then.
Simpsons did it, though as thinly spread as it gets.
Southpark had basically no progression until they had an entire season with nothing but a progressing story.
